Lot Description
George V silver salver of circular form, raised shaped rim, central engraving relating to The Lancashire Fusiliers and raised on four hoof feet. Hallmarked Barker Brothers (Herbert Edward Barker & Frank Ernest Barker) Chester 1917. Diameter measuring 10 1//2 inches (26.5 cm), weight 17.5 ozt (544 grams).
'Presented to Major W.H. Lowe by the officers of (res.) Batt. 6th Lancashire Fusiliers on the occasion of his marriage, 14th Aug. 1918.'

Condition Report
The salver displays general scratches, marks, wear and tarnishing commensurate with the age and use. The feet have obvioulsy taken a know as the salver wobbles on a flat surface. A couple of minor dints along with a few deeper scratches and scuffs. The hallmarks are clear and legible, maker's mark partly rubbed.
